Belt Filter Presses: A Comprehensive Guide

Such machines are widely employed in various sectors for solid extraction – primarily in wastewater treatment. Conveyor screening equipment function by transporting a cake of materials and liquids between two continuous belts. During the strips move through a squeeze zone – typically with drums – water is drained, resulting in a dewatered waste. The method creates a substantial diminishment in liquidity, making the sludge more suitable for disposal.

Belt Filter Press Maintenance: Best Practices

Regular servicing of your mesh pressing unit is essential for ensuring optimal efficiency and lengthening its lifespan . Follow a scheduled plan that covers regular visual inspections for evidence of wear , such as belt tears or drive components issues. Lubrication of rotating sections is also vital , as is cleaning solids from the pressing area. Lastly , periodic overhauls by qualified engineers can uncover impending concerns before they result in significant downtime and repairs .
